Abstract
The synthesis and pharmacological evaluation of methoxyindazoles as new inh ibitors of neuronal nitric oxide synthase are presented. The 7-methoxyindaz ole, although less potent than 7-NI, is the most active compound of the ser ies in Lin in vitro enzymatic assay of neuronal nitric oxide synthase activ ity. This result shows that the nitro-substitution is not indispensable to the biological activity of the indazole ring. 7-Methoxyindazole possesses i n vivo NOS inhibitory as well and related antinociceptive properties, (C) 2 001 Elsevier Science Ltd.
